Think carefully about what part of your home will be the designated school area. It should be roomy and comfortable, but not in a distracting area. In addition to a desk area for writing and exams, you will need an open space for activities such as dancing or science experiments. You should also have the ability to check on them at all times in the area.

Be sure your children plenty of hands-on learning. You could for instance have them take care of a plant or cook foods which apply to the topic they’re learning. An example would be to cook cabbage rolls when studying Stalin.If you are learning about WWII then consider visiting a military museum or a historical site. Learning with active senses helps information stick.

Try not to neglect your partner while juggling homeschooling with all of your other responsibilities. Spend time with your partner so that you don’t spend every waking moment teaching or researching. Show them they’re important to you by doing activities like going on dates or to the movies, or spending quiet time together. Spending even a small amount of time together each day has a big impact on the quality of your relationship.
